There are plenty of methods and techniques one can apply to ensure security within the household when using this item. While this item has a lot of advantages like being a cost effective alternative, it is the cause of plenty of accidents from happening. To prevent this from happening to you, stated below are some essential safety guidelines to consider when using commercial attic ladders.
One of the most basic things one can do to avoid accidents is to always use both your hands when utilizing it. If you need to carry things up or down, ask someone else to receive the item before heading their way. Majority of falls occur when a person is too careless and could either result in damaged body parts, or items as a result of the fall.
When having this device installed in your attic, you have probably thought of enlisting the help of a contractor to get the job done for you. This is actually an excellent idea because it minimizes the chances of errors and maximizes the success rate of having it installed. One of the aspects that contractors consider is any electrical sources nearby that might conduct electricity especially when the ladder is steel.
The key to avoid accidents is to conduct regular maintenance work. This entails checking up on the ladder from time to time to see if it is still fit for its purpose. When it starts to show signs of wear and tear, perhaps it would be best to have it replaced, or do the necessary repair work.
Rather than go through the hassle of an injury, it is better to prevent these things from happening instead. One way to ensure security is to make sure that it fits properly and is the best choice for your needs. If you are unsure about which one to get, consult a contractor because these people are knowledge about this field of work and can help you greatly.
Following this logic, it is highly important to get the right kind of attic ladder that will suit the purpose that was intended for it. If you are purchasing one simply to use it for climbing up and down, you do not necessarily have to purchase a heavy one. However, this would also depend upon other factors, like the weight of the persons using it.
Nowadays, there are plenty of knock off or imitation items that are way cheaper compared to original items. Even though they are cheap, these things are also easily breakable and does not have any warranties with it. Always purchase items from a reliable source, like established hardware shops and stores.
When it comes to security, one can never be too careful. Do not neglect to consider the purpose, weight, and quality of the ladders being used. By following these guidelines, you will avoid a high percentage of accidents from happening in your household.
